this seems quite easy to me.... but I don't know how to "move around" to actually implement/propose the required changes.

To make grub aware of gzip (as it already is of lzjb) the steps should be:

1. create a new
/onnv-gate/usr/src/grub/grub-0.95/stage2/zfs_gzip.c
starting from
/onnv-gate/usr/src/uts/common/fs/zfs/gzip.c
and removing the gzip_compress funcion

2. add gzip_decompress
at the end of
/onnv-gate/usr/src/grub/grub-0.95/stage2/fsys_zfs.h

3. update the decomp_table function to link "gzip" and all "gzip- N" (with N=1...9) to the gzip_decompress function in
/onnv-gate/usr/src/grub/grub-0.95/stage2/fsys_zfs.c

using VirtualBox I just tried to move an OpenSolaris 2008.05 boot environment (ZFS) on a gzip-9 compressed dataset, but I have the following error from grub:
Error 16: Inconsistent filesystem structure
Googling around I found the same error with ZFS boot and Xen in July 2007:
http://mail.opensolaris.org/pipermail/xen-discuss/2007-July/000961.html
http://bugs.opensolaris.org/bugdatabase/printableBug.do?bug_id=6584697
That was fixed.. Is mine another bug?

This is because grub does not support booting from gzip-compressed datasets now. At this moment only LZJB algorithm is supported, please see decomp_table here:

http://src.opensolaris.org/source/xref/onnv/onnv-gate/usr/src/grub/grub-0.95/stage2/fsys_zfs.c#65
